Output 320aecfc70908bf03abcfd44eb4f76c749e838f9fa3f50ce57d56dd385c8cf60: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66070116d47c7ade8ece3839ae73060b3b0070a OP_EQUAL
address
3JKLS52rx71p5RoHxf8dqk4drkwkj9fzFz
transaction
320aecfc70908bf03abcfd44eb4f76c749e838f9fa3f50ce57d56dd385c8cf60
spent
true